I'm the new "Coffin Dodger" from Preston, Lancs aged 71. I have had type 2 Diabetes for a few years but six months ago the Medical Practice Nurse read me the "Riot Act" about getting my diet, drink and exercise under control.....or else! So I decided for once in my life to listen to advice (My wife reckons that is sooooo unlike me), get my old bike out of the shed, turn out the "Man Drawer" to find the cycle clips and get peddaling. In the last six months I have lost two and a half stone and am now down from 14 stone to 11st 7 and feeling much better for it. As a reward I have just bought myself a new bike. The old bike is a 1950s "New Hudson" that I inherited from my Uncle in the 80s so I reckoned that as it didn't owe me anything I would have a change and get something with more than three gears. I am now the proud owner of one of Mr Halford's finest... an Apollo Belmont and am loving it.
